Ravens nose tackle Michael Pierce to have season-ending surgery
Chris Pedota, NorthJersey.com / USA TODAY NETWORK This will be the fourth season-ending injury for the Ravens Baltimore Ravens veteran nose tackle Michael Pierce will undergo season-ending surgery on his torn biceps, an injury he sustained in the Ravens’ Week 3 victory over the New England Patriots.
